Abstract :
W-Cu composites were used as starter materials of the thermionic cathode matrices for microwave tubes. However the decopperization affects their microstructure. An apparatus and an experimental procedure were developed to reduce the damages introduced during the decopperization. The matrix porosity (34.6%) was analyzed by SEM and its composition was determined by EDX.
